こどもプログラミング

Scratch作例

【Scratch】宇宙旅行

星が動き続けるプログラムです。星はペンで描画しています
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】気象予報士

「気象予報士」を作りました。ネットから気象情報を取得して、天気に合ったポーズをとるロボットです 公式の教員向けレッスンプランはこちらです 予報する前の状態です 晴れの時はサングラスをかけます 雨の時は傘をさします プログラムはこちらです P...
Scratch作例

【Scratch】虹ペン

虹を描くペンです。にゅるーっとした動きが気持ちいいです GIFアニメで見る アレンジして歯磨き粉にしてみました
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】エクササイズトレーナー

エクササイズトーレナーのレオを作りました。腹筋をするロボットです。プログラミングで設定した回数だけ腹筋します 公式の教員向けのレッスンプランはこちらです 眉毛の角度を間違えて、ちょっと情けない顔になってしましました(^^; 本当はキリッとし...
プログラミングコンテスト

【Scratch】Why!?大喜利 9月のお題発表!【2022.10.3(月)〆切】

9月のお題は『「〇〇の秋」をテーマに自由に作ろう』です。スポーツの秋、食欲の秋、読書の秋・・・といろいろありますね 用意されている素材は「〇〇の秋」という文字のみ。なかなか斬新 締め切りは2022.10.3(月)です!
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】ブレイクダンサー

「ブレイクダンサー」を作りました。腕と脚を使ってダンスするロボットです 公式の教員向けのレッスンプランはこちらです 全ての動きのタイミングが合うようにプログラミングします Pythonバージョン。一応、ダンスはしますが、ブロックプログラミン...
Scratch作例

【Scratch】枯山水

枯山水のような描画をするプログラムです。ネコはゆっくりマウスを追いかけてきます。マウスダウンで描画します GIFアニメで見る
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】荷物を自動選別するロボット

「自動化ロボット」を作成しました。荷物を色で選別する工場ロボットです 公式の教員向けレッスンプランはこちらです ブロックをじーっと見つめて色を調べます 公式サイトの「荷物」の組み立て図のPDF(automate-it-bi-pdf-book...
Scratch作例

【Scratch】ネコをふちどる

ネコをふちどるプログラムです。ふちどりはスタンプを使って描画しています GIFアニメで見る
既存の教科でプログラミング授業

【既存の教科でプログラミング授業】中学2年生 数学「y = 2x + b のグラフ」

y = 2x + b のグラフを描画するプログラムです 変数bの値は-10から10の範囲で変更できます 参考 東京書籍 新編 新しい数学2 62ページ 1次関数の性質と調べ方
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】安全な金庫

「金庫」を改良して「安全な金庫」を作りました 前回の「金庫」はこちら 公式の教員向けのレッスンプランはこちらです 死神の持っている草刈り鎌のようなパーツが今回追加したものです 使っていなかったモーターも利用します 開始と同時にダイヤルカバー...
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】金庫

「金庫」を作りました モーターを使って鍵をかけます。ダイアルを合わせることで鍵を開けることができます 公式の教員向けレッスンプランはこちらです 正面から見たところです。右のモーターが鍵をかけるためのもの。左のモーターは鍵を開くためのものです...
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】配達物追跡

「トラッカー」を作りました。基本的には「CNC装置」と同じです 教員向けのレッスンプランはこちらです 「CNC装置」はペンで図形を描画しましたが、「トラッカー」は地図上の道に沿ってトラッカーを動かします センサーで地図を読み取って自動でトラ...
Scratch作例

【Scratch】虹を描くねこ

ネコの動いた後に虹ができます。虹はペンで描画しています GIFアニメで見る
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】自動配送システム

「自動配送システム」を作りました。距離センサーを使った車です こちらが公式の教員向けのレッスンプランです 進行方向に距離センサーがついています 裏側です。前進・後退用のモーター2つとハンドル操作用のモーター1つを搭載しています こちらがプロ...
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】品質検査システム

「品質検査システム」を作成しました。カラーセンサーを使って、ブロックの色を判定するロボットです 公式の教員向けのレッスンプランはこちらです カラーセンサーに紫のブロックをかざすと品質OK(色はプログラム次第です) 緑のブロックだと品質NGで...
既存の教科でプログラミング授業

【既存の教科でプログラミング授業】中学2年生 数学「y = ax + 2 のグラフ」

y = ax + 2 のグラフを描画するプログラムです 変数aの値は-10から10の範囲で変更できます 参考 東京書籍 新編 新しい数学2 62ページ 1次関数の性質と調べ方
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】ロボットアーム

ロボットアームを作ってみました。作り方は専用アプリの中にはなく、公式サイトでPDFが公開されています 公式の教員向けレッスンプランはこちらです ただし、ロボットアームの先端部分の作り方は紹介されていないみたいなので、自分で工夫して作る必要が...
LEGO SPIKE

【レゴエデュケーション SPIKE プライム】Pythonで利用できるライトマトリックスの画像名一覧

show_imageの引数に画像名を指定することで、プリセットの画像を表示することができます。 この画像名と画像を一覧としてまとめました from spike import PrimeHub, LightMatrix hub = Prime...
Scratch作例

【Scratch】モンドリアンのコンポジション

ピートモンドリアンのコンポジションを描画するプログラムです GIFアニメで見る